Current product behavior
- Inspect sources and extracted articles for the workspace.
- Re-crawl an individual web source or sync all crawl sources.
- Enable weekly synchronization for crawl sources.
- Review article count, corpus size, sync state, and content no longer linked from its source.
- Remove a source and its extracted content.
- Search the configured scope during a wizard, Guidance, or Resource Center request.
- Read a matching article in bounded windows rather than loading the entire corpus into every request.
